    Default Qt 4.7.3 SDK LGPL includes no Qt Libraries

    Is it me, or are there no precompiled Qt Libraries in the latest Qt SDK?

    I'm downloading the latest 4.7.3 LGPL version: "Qt SDK for Windows". It is only 15MB. The description at "http://qt.nokia.com/downloads/" says that the complete development environment includes the libraries.

    Default Re: Qt 4.7.3 SDK LGPL includes no Qt Libraries

    The ~15MB installer is an application that will download files (only the files you select to install) from their servers and install them - a so called online installer.

    Default Re: Qt 4.7.3 SDK LGPL includes no Qt Libraries

    ah, okay, I re-ran the web installer and got the libraries this time. Maybe I unchecked too many items the first time.

    The libraries are tucked in under the mingw directory. I suppose that is because that is the compiler was used to build it.
